Cheesy Texas toast is a delicious and easy-to-make side dish or snack. It’s perfect for pairing with soups, salads, or just enjoying on its own.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 loaf of thick-cut bread
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/2 cup butter, softened
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 tablespoon chopped parsley (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 450°F (230°C).
- In a bowl, mix softened butter, minced garlic, salt, and black pepper.
- Spread the garlic butter mixture on one side of each slice of bread.
- Place the bread butter-side up on a baking sheet.
- S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ese evenly over each slice.
- Bake for 10-12 minutes, until the cheese is bubbly and golden.
- Garnish with chopped parsley if desired.
- Serve hot and enjoy.
